## **TgardTM K52 Thermally Conductive Insulators** ## - e— ## **HIGH THERMAL AND DIELECTRIC PERFORMANCE INSULATOR PAD** Tgard[TM] K52 is a high thermal and dielectric performance insulator pad consisting of a ceramic filled phase change compound coated on MT Kapton film. Tgard[TM] K52 phase change coating all but eliminates contact thermal resistance. The phase change coating melts at 52ºC and replaces all contact areas that contain air. Tgard[TM] K52-1 is ideal for applications requiring the best thermal performing insulator material. Tgard[TM] K52-2 has the best balance of thermal, dielectric and cut through performance. Tgard[TM] K52-3 is a 3 mil MT Kapton film that provides the best crush and cut and tear resistance available with thermal properties that are still in the high performance category. ## **FEATURES AND BENEFITS** - High breakdown voltage of 4,000 – 9,000 range VAC - Resistant to tears and cut through - Total thermal resistance of 0.13 - 0.30 range ºC-in2/watt at 20 psi clip force ## **APPLICATIONS** - Audio amps - Power modules - Switching mode power supplies Americas: +1.800.843.4556 Europe: +49.8031.2460.0 Asia: +86.755.2714.1166 CLV-customerservice@lairdtech.com **www.lairdtech.com/thermal** **TgardTM K52 Thermally Conductive Insulators** **==> picture [90 x 47] intentionally omitted <==** **==> picture [358 x 286] intentionally omitted <==** **----- Start of picture text -----**<br> PROPERTY TEST METHOD K52-1 K52-2 K52-3<br>ELECTRICAL PROPERTIES<br>Dielectric Withstand Voltage<br>ASTM D149 3,000 volts DC 6,000 volts DC 7,500 volts DC<br>6.4mm probe for 30 sec.<br>Dielectric Breakdown Voltage<br>ASTM D149 4,200 volts AC 7,800 volts AC 9,000 volts AC<br>6.4mm probe<br>Volume Resistivity ASTM D257 4 x 10 [14] 4 x 10 [14] 4 x 10 [14]<br>Dielectric Constant @ 1 MHz ASTM D257 1.8 1.8 1.8<br>MECHANICAL PROPERTIES<br>Composite Thickness ASTM D374 2 mil (0.051mm) 3 mil (0.076mm) 4 mil (0.102mm)<br>MT Kapton [®] Thickness ASTM D374 1 mil (0.025mm) 2 mil (0.051mm) 3 mil (0.076mm)<br>Tensile Strength ASTM D412 13.5 kpsi (93 mPa) 18 kpsi (124 mPa) 20 kpsi (139 mPa)<br>Elongation MD ASTM D412 80% 80% 80%<br>Operating Temperature Range -60 - 150ºC -60 - 150ºC -60 - 150ºC<br>Color Light amber Light amber Medium amber<br>PRESSURE, PSI (KPA) 10 (69) 20 (138) 50 (345) 100 (689) 200 (1379) 400 (2758)<br>TOTAL THERMAL RESISTANCE<br>˚C-in²/watt (˚C-cm²/watt)<br>K52-1 0.14 (0.90) 0.14 (0.90) 0.13 (0.84) 0.13 (0.84) 0.13 (0.84) 0.13 (0.84)<br>K52-2 0.23 (1.48) 0.23 (1.48) 0.22 (1.42) 0.22 (1.42) 0.22 (1.42) 0.22 (1.42)<br>K52-3 0.33 (2.13) 0.32 (2.06) 0.31 (2.00) 0.30 (1.94) 0.30 (1.94) 0.30 (1.94)<br>**----- End of picture text -----**<br> STANDARD DIE CUT PARTS: CUSTOM DIE CUT PARTS: ## PRESSURE SENSITIVE ADHESIVE: Standard part sizes for TO-220, TO-247, TO-3P, TO-3PL, and TO-264 Custom configurations available with standard tolerance of 0.5mm (0.020”) Ability to handle drawings in multiple file formats.
